    Identify the type of reactions taking place in each of the following: 

    a. Barium chloride solution is mixed with copper sulphate solution and white precipitate is formed. 

    b. On heating copper powder in china dish, the surface of copper powder turns black. 

    c. On heating green coloured ferrous sulphate crystals, raddish brown solid is left and smell of a gas having odour of burning sulphur is experienced. 

    d. Iron nails when left dipped in blue copper sulphate solution become reddish brown in colour and the blue colour of copper sulphate fades away. 

    e. Quick lime reacts vigorously with water releasing a large amount of heat.
